clutch puller snapped off - now what?
ugh
have a 2000 DS and can't get the primary clutch off. I was getting worried I was going to bend my good hardened puller so I put the el cheapo in to wack it a few times with my bfh. nothing budging and then when I went to remove the puller it snapped off. grr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rrr So now not only is the froze clutch still on the crank but it has a puller stuck in it. This is the second of 5 carts I have tried to pull the primary and it refused to pop off. I am using an impact and it just seems like these are way over torqued from club car? I have probably pulled 100+ snowmobile clutches and only 1 time did I have one I couldn't remove. At this point I'm going to just cut it off but is this a common problem with these? |
